I worked on a G&G M14 recently. Air nozzle should be replaced as the stock nozzle does not have an O-ring and the cylinder head is just a piece of metal, no impact pad of any sort, so one should be installed. Other than that the internals should be ok.
Externally I found the finish to be good but grey and plastic-like. You should look into the CA M14, it has some problems of its own but the metal parts look and feel like metal instead of plastic. Having analyzed, fired and stripped both side by side, they're both pretty decent M14s. |
